Notice of Bids Bid Notice __________________________ CITY OF JACKSONVILLE INVITATION TO BID BIDS MUST BE RECEIVED BY THE CITY OF JACKSONVILLE PROCUREMENT DIVISION IN 1CLOUD BY NO LATER THAN THE DATE AND TIME BELOW. THURSDAY 5/7/26 10:00 AM 1Cloud E-Bidding System 17733-26 2nd Avenue North Roadway Safety Improvements Ben Kemp ANALYST (904)255-8820 SCOPE OF WORK: Work consists of furnishing all labor, materials, and equipment and performing all operations necessary for reconstructing 2nd Avenue North from 20th Street to Mike McCue Park and Boat Ramp in Jacksonville Beach, Florida. The work includes, but is not limited to: earthwork, roadway reconstruction, box culvert installation, pond construction, shared use path construction, concrete curb & gutter construction, milling & resurfacing, parking lot construction, drainage structure & pipe installation, sodding, maintenance of traffic, erosion control & pollution abatement, eagle nest monitoring, and all other related work in accordance with the Contract Drawings and Specifications. Construction completion within 730 days from notice to proceed.. PRE-BID CONFERENCE n/a DONNA DEGAN, MAYOR CITY OF JACKSONVILLE, FLORIDA DUSTIN FREEMAN, CHIEF PROCUREMENT DIVISION Apr. 2 (26-01907D)
